Selecting Your First Crochet Top Pattern

Your first step is choosing a suitable free crochet top pattern. Consider your current skill level and the time you can dedicate this weekend. Look for patterns labeled ‘beginner’ or ‘easy’ if you are new to garment making. These typically use basic stitches and have clear, step-by-step instructions.

Pay close attention to the suggested yarn type and hook size in the pattern. Using the recommended materials will help you achieve the correct gauge and fit. Think about the style you want—boho, fitted, or lacy—and browse platforms like Ravelry, which hosts a massive database of free patterns. This will help you narrow down your perfect project.

Essential Materials and Setup

Gathering your materials is part of the fun. You will need yarn, a crochet hook, scissors, and a yarn needle. Choose a comfortable, breathable yarn like cotton or a cotton blend for a summer top. Ensure your hook size matches the pattern’s requirements to maintain the correct tension.

Create a dedicated, cozy space for your weekend craft. Good lighting is crucial for seeing your stitches clearly. Keep your pattern, whether printed or on a tablet, within easy reach. Organizing your tools beforehand makes the process smooth and enjoyable, turning it into a true weekend ritual.

Following and Customizing Your Pattern

Read through the entire free crochet top pattern before you begin. Familiarize yourself with any special stitches or abbreviations used. Start by making a gauge swatch; this ensures your finished top will fit as intended. It might seem like an extra step, but it prevents disappointment later.

Don’t be afraid to make the pattern your own. You can adjust the length or add simple stripes for a personal touch. As you gain confidence, you might modify sleeve styles or necklines. The beauty of a free crochet top pattern is that it serves as a foundation for your creativity.

Each modification makes the garment uniquely yours.
